System Errors
The following errors may occur while you are operating this
system. You may be required to perform some action.
If you perform the recommended actions and the condition
still remains, contact authorized service personnel. See
“How to Reach Us” to find out how to contact GE Medical
Systems Information Technologies.
153A, 154A, 209A
Problem Cause Solution
appears on the screen. No battery is installed in the system. Install a battery and connect the system to an AC
wall outlet to charge the battery.
flashes intermittently. The battery charge is low. Connect the system to an AC wall outlet to charge
the battery.
appears on the screen. The writer door is open. Close the writer door.
The system does not power up when operating
from battery power.
The battery is empty. Connect the system to an AC wall outlet to charge
the battery.
The system shuts down when operating from
battery power.
Battery is empty, or the Automatic Shutdown
feature is enabled.
Connect the system to an AC wall outlet to charge
the battery, or power on the system.
“X” Lead disconnected message appears. Electrode(s) disconnected. Reconnect the electrode(s).
MODEM ERROR. The remote device is not
responding. Would you like to retry?
Modem not connected. (If wireless option, client
bridge not connected.)
Connect and retry.
(Wireless option only) MAC 5000 is not within
range of access point.
Relocate MAC 5000 to within range of access
point and retry transmission.
